Benefits to working with us

In addition to flexible working and the ability to work from modern offices in North London or one of our Houses, we offer the following benefits to all staff:

Carer’s Leave

Employees who act as carers for a dependant are entitled to:

  • One week of paid leave every 12 months

Charity Sick Pay

Employees receive:

  • 25 days’ charity sick pay per tax year

  • Pro‑rata entitlement for part‑time employees

Pension Scheme and Life Assurance

All employees have access to:

  • A Stakeholder Pension Plan

  • Life assurance cover of 1x annual salary as a minimum

  • The option to upgrade life assurance to 4x annual salary

Training and Development

All employees benefit from:

  • An extensive internal learning pathway

  • In‑person and online training

  • The ability to apply for specialist training to gain additional, relevant qualifications

Enhanced Family Leave

After one year’s continuous service, employees are entitled to:

  • Enhanced maternity, paternity and adoption leave

Pet‑ernity Friendly Leave

Employees with pets are entitled to time off to:

  • Welcome a new pet

  • Attend veterinary appointments

  • Cope with the loss of a pet

Private Healthcare

All staff are eligible for access to a private medical healthcare scheme covering:

  • The employee

  • Their spouse or civil partner

  • Dependant children up to the age of 25

Doctor@Hand and Employee Assistance Programme

Employees have access to:

  • Doctor@Hand services

  • A free Employee Assistance Programme

Employee Discount Scheme

All employees can access:

  • Discounts via Rewards Gateway and Charity Workers Discounts

  • Savings across a wide range of High Street and online retailers

Gym Discount

Employees have access to:

  • A variety of fitness and gym discounts, including PureGym

Annual Leave and Sabbatical Leave

Employees benefit from:

  • Enhanced annual leave entitlement

  • The option to purchase up to three additional days’ annual leave each year

  • A paid sabbatical of eight weeks after 10 years’ continuous service

  • An additional four weeks’ paid leave every five years thereafter

Recognition

Employees are recognised through:

  • A Service Award card and voucher, increasing in value every five years
  • The Shining Star Scheme, recognising up to five employees per quarter, each receiving a £50 voucher
  • Excellence Awards, with nominations open twice per year for outstanding contributions across the charity
